
数据不仅是企业决策的重要依据,更是驱动业务创新、提升竞争力的核心资源
然而,随着数据量的爆炸性增长,如何高效、安全地管理这些数据成为了企业面临的一大挑战
特别是在使用优化行存储(ORC,Optimized Row Columnar)格式的环境中,由于其高效的数据压缩和读取性能,被广泛应用于大数据处理和分析领域
在这样的背景下,ORC环境数据库备份显得尤为重要,它是保障数据安全、实现业务连续性的基石
一、ORC环境概述及其数据特性 ORC(Optimized Row Columnar)是由Apache Hadoop生态系统中的Apache Hive项目开发的,专为大数据处理场景设计的存储格式
与传统的行存储和列存储相比,ORC结合了两者的优点,实现了更高效的数据读写和压缩
它支持复杂的数据类型和高效的谓词下推(Predicate Pushdown),能够显著提升查询性能,减少I/O开销
ORC格式的数据特性主要包括: 1.高效压缩:通过Zlib、Snappy等压缩算法,有效减少存储空间占用
2.快速读取:利用列式存储的特点,只读取查询所需的列,加速数据访问速度
3.索引优化:内置的行组和索引结构,使得数据查找更加迅速
4.数据完整性校验:通过校验和(Checksum)机制,确保数据在传输和存储过程中的完整性
二、为何ORC环境数据库备份至关重要 尽管ORC格式提供了诸多优势,但在享受其带来的性能提升的同时,企业也面临着新的数据保护挑战
一旦数据发生丢失、损坏或被非法访问,将可能导致严重的业务中断、财务损失乃至法律风险
因此,实施有效的ORC环境数据库备份策略,对于确保数据安全、维护业务连续性具有不可估量的价值
1.防范数据丢失:无论是硬件故障、自然灾害还是人为错误,都可能导致数据丢失
定期备份可以确保即使发生意外,也能迅速恢复数据,减少损失
2.应对数据增长:随着业务的发展,数据量不断增长,备份不仅是对现有数据的保护,也是为未来数据扩展预留空间,确保系统能够持续稳定运行
3.满足合规要求:许多行业和地区都有关于数据保护和隐私的法律要求,如GDPR(欧盟通用数据保护条例)
备份是证明企业遵守这些法规、保护用户隐私的重要手段
4.促进灾难恢复:在遭遇大规模系统故障或灾难性事件时,备份是恢复业务运营的唯一途径,能够最大限度地缩短恢复时间目标(RTO)和恢复点目标(RPO)
三、ORC环境数据库备份的最佳实践 1.制定全面的备份计划 -定期备份:根据数据变化频率和业务重要性,设定合理的备份周期,如每日、每周或每月
-全量备份与增量/差异备份结合:初次进行全量备份后,后续采用增量或差异备份以减少备份时间和存储空间占用
-备份窗口优化:选择业务低峰期进行备份,减少对正常业务操作的影响
2.选择合适的备份工具和技术 -自动化备份工具:利用如Apache Sqoop、Hadoop DistCp等工具,实现ORC文件的自动化备份
-云存储服务:将备份数据存储在云端,利用云服务商提供的冗余、加密和跨区域复制功能,增强数据的安全性和可用性
-数据库快照技术:对于支持快照功能的数据库系统,如Amazon RDS for Oracle,可以利用快照进行快速备份,减少备份时间
3.加强备份数据的安全管理 -加密备份数据:无论是存储还是传输过程中,都应采用强加密算法对备份数据进行加密,防止数据泄露
-访问控制:实施严格的访问权限管理,确保只有授权人员能够访问备份数据
-备份验证与测试:定期对备份数据进行恢复测试,验证备份的有效性和完整性,确保在需要时能够顺利恢复
4.建立灾难恢复计划 -制定详细的恢复步骤:包括识别关键业务、确定恢复优先级、选择恢复策略等
-培训团队:确保IT团队熟悉备份和恢复流程,能够在紧急情况下迅速响应
-定期演练:通过模拟真实场景的灾难恢复演练,检验恢复计划的可行性和团队的反应速度
四、未来展望:智能化与自动化趋势 随着人工智能和机器学习技术的发展,ORC环境数据库备份将向更加智能化、自动化的方向发展
例如,利用AI算法预测数据增长趋势,动态调整备份策略;通过机器学习模型识别异常数据访问模式,及时发现并响应潜在的安全威胁
此外,随着云原生技术的普及,备份解决方案将更加紧密地与云平台集成,实现备份资源的弹性扩展、按需付费,进一步降低企业成本,提升备份效率
总之,ORC环境数据库备份是企业数据保护战略中不可或缺的一环
通过实施科学的备份策略、采用先进的技术手段、加强安全管理,企业能够有效抵御数据风险,确保业务的连续性和数据的完整性,为企业的长远发展奠定坚实的基础
在数字化转型的浪潮中,让我们携手并进,共同守护数据的未来
VB.NET远程DB访问与本地数据备份指南
ORC环境数据库高效备份指南
SQL备份全库表技巧揭秘
打造高效数据库同步备份工具秘籍
电力企业数据备份:保障运营安全的关键
云部署备份服务器地址指南
数据无忧:高效文件备份,打造安全可靠的服务器存储方案
VB.NET远程DB访问与本地数据备份指南
打造高效数据库同步备份工具秘籍
电力企业数据备份:保障运营安全的关键
数据无忧:高效文件备份,打造安全可靠的服务器存储方案
服务器裸机备份:确保数据安全之策
SQL Server Master数据库备份指南
DB2备份引锁表,数据操作需留心
DedeCMS数据库备份文件存放位置解析
数据库备份恢复考题精解指南
服务器上的宝藏:确保数据安全的高效备份策略
掌握备份服务器IP,数据安全无忧
企业微信邮件备份,数据守护秘籍